Why Attending To Financial Health Is Key to Labor Force Security

The American Psychological Association (APA) has actually regularly reported that monetary concerns are one of the leading sources of anxiety for grownups in the U.S. Over 70% of participants in a current APA study stated that money concerns are a considerable stressor in their lives. This tension has straight effects for workplace performance: workers sidetracked by individual economic issues are more probable to experience burnout, miss due dates, and choose brand-new job chances with greater wages to cover their financial debts.

Monetarily stressed workers are additionally a lot more susceptible to health and wellness problems, such as anxiousness, anxiety, and high blood pressure, which contribute to raised medical care expenses for companies. Resolving this trouble early, with comprehensive financial debt resolution solutions, can alleviate these threats and promote a much healthier, more steady labor force.
